DBS Class 66 66060 nears Marsh Lane crossing with a train of domestic waste containers from Cricklewood (colloquially known as a 'binliner' train) heading for the landfill site at the old Calvert brickworks. Network Rail were working at the crossing, hence their van parked alongside.
